Web21 mrt. 2024 · Coverage: The milk paint finish offered less coverage and seemed to be less pigmented compared to the chalked paint. You can see in the photo how the chalked paint provides more coverage after the first coat. Finish: The milk paint dried to a very matte finish that felt rough to the touch.
